Senior System Mechanical Engineer

Job Summary

The Senior System Mechanical Engineer will lead our advancements in tracker product vision, innovation, enhancements, and improvements, as you drive our next-generation products and features. Working with multiple levels of management, engineering, and other departments, you will create and select state-of-the-art technologies and products.  You will utilize tools such as computer aided design (CAD), finite element analysis (FEA) and design for manufacturability and assembly (DFMA) and failure modes and effects analysis (DFMEA).  This position may require occasional evening and weekend hours. Some travel will be required.

Key Job Responsibilities

  • Be assigned parts and sub-assemblies to lead responses to engineering change requests.
  • Lead root cause analysis and related test requests and needed redesign to address field failures.
  • Provide clear direction to cross-functional teams with uncompromising drive to meet program targets.
  • Represent engineering in developing/managing the product road map for assigned product.
  • Incorporate increased ‘design for manufacturing’ in existing or new part development.
  • Report status of assigned programs at various levels of the organization.
  • Generate all design review records and all required design analysis to support the part design.
  • Develop design record documents in compliance with company requirements
  • Create Design Requirements Documents (DRD) based on Market Requirements Documents (MRD) created by Product Management.
  • Create plans for component and system tests and interpret results to demonstrate that designs meet requirements.
  • Create documents and presentations supporting stage gate reviews.
  • Read and process engineering documents, including process design guidelines, manufacturing drawings, and engineering best practices guides.
  • Lead activities to optimize and drive the engineering process for new product development projects, developing operating strategies, plans or procedures.
  • Create design concepts using SolidWorks and analyze them for suitability using DFMA, FMEA, FEA, etc. as appropriate.
  • Work with Mechanical Designers to create detailed CAD models and drawings.
  • Develop timelines and cost estimates for development tasks and appraise management of performance to plan.
  • Work with the Quality dept. to develop inspection and test plans for supplier qualification of new components and sub-assemblies.
  • Assess reliability, safety, performance, and risk of new designs & methodologies; coordinate and communicate development schedules and compatibility or design issues throughout the team continuously.
  • Oversee testing and theoretical analysis of products to determine product safety and efficacy.
  • Travel to project sites, labs, suppliers, as required.
  • Other duties as assigned.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in Mechanical Engineering or similar discipline
  • 10 years of experience developing mechanical components and systems for new products.
  • 5 years of experience performing mechanical engineering hand-calculations
  • 5 years design experience designing structural components and hardware, gearing and/or drivetrains.
  • 5 years of experience utilizing FEA, DFMA and design for cost in the development of new products.
  • 5 years of experience using 3D CAD software
  • 5 years of experience defining design validation tests
  • 2 years working in an environment with Stage Gate Product Development Processes
  • 2 years of experience using SolidWorks
  • 2 years of experience using Microsoft Office Suite

Preferred Qualifications

  • Master’s degree in mechanical engineering or similar discipline
  • Ability to effectively work on multiple projects concurrently
  • Excellent communication and team building skills
  • Organizational and time-management skills
  • Experience in the solar industry
  • Ability to work in a fast paced, smaller company environment
